Vanessa Trump shares emotional update on cancer fight


Vanessa Trump shares a candid update on her breast cancer journey as she continues treatment with the support of loved ones, including her boyfriend, Tiger Woods. The former model offered the health update on social media just one day after Woods reportedly returned to the US following a stint in rehab.

Taking to Instagram on Saturday, Vanessa revealed that she continues to recover after recently undergoing surgery as part of her treatment plan.

“Over the past four weeks I have been recovering from surgery and I am grateful to be healing and moving forward. Soon I will begin the second phase of my treatment,” Trump wrote. “Sending love, strength and hope to everyone fighting this battle.”

The 48-year-old did not share further details about her surgery or what her second phase of treatment will entail.

Vanessa first in public revealed his diagnosis last monthand told supporters she was working closely with doctors on a way forward. “I stay focused and hopeful while surrounded by the love and support of my family, my children and those closest to me,” she previously shared.

After thanking supporters for their encouragement, Vanessa added: “I am kindly asking for privacy while I focus on my health and recovery.”

After Vanessa’s initial announcement, members of the Trump family quickly rallied around her publicly. Her former sister-in-law, Ivanka Trumpcommented on the post with a heartfelt message of support. “Praying for your continued strength and a speedy recovery. Love you mom,” Ivanka wrote.

Vanessa shares five children, Kai, Donald III, Tristan, Spencer and Chloe, with ex-husband Donald Trump Jr., whom she divorced in 2018. Last month, the former couple reunited to celebrate daughter Kai’s high school graduation with Donald Jr.’s wife, Bettina Anderson, and other family members, including Tiff Boulosy Trump.

While Vanessa continues her health battle, sources previously claimed Woods made it a priority to support her in the midst of her cancer diagnosis. According to an insider who spoke in late May, the golf legend reportedly believed he “needed to be with” Vanessa after learning of her diagnosis, prompting him to temporarily pause treatment and return to Florida.

“He and Vanessa are close and share their lives. He needed to be with her and he was. They do what they can for the other in light of the fact that they both have heavy schedules of responsibilities,” the source said at the time. “Life brings unexpected twists and turns, and so far they’ve both been there to help the other. They’re lucky to have found each other.”

Another Florida-based source previously told PEOPLE that the couple has remained a steady source of support for each other despite their own personal challenges. “Tiger and Vanessa have been supportive of each other in all endeavors and I don’t see that changing in the coming days,” the source said, referring to both Vanessa’s cancer diagnosis and Woods’ ongoing legal issues stemming from from his DUI case.

“No matter how well put together and organized she has been as a mother, ex-wife and girlfriend, the demands and stresses of life today are taking a toll,” the insider added, praising Vanessa’s resilience and noting that she has “the right attitude” to navigate the difficult period.

Vanessa’s update comes shortly after Woods reportedly checked out of a rehabilitation facility in Switzerland following his March arrest on DUI-related charges. According to Page sixthe golf icon returned to the US on Friday and was photographed after landing at a private airport in Jupiter, Florida.

Woods, who reportedly began dating Vanessa in late 2024, was notably absent from the family’s graduation dinner in Naples, but briefly attended Kai’s commencement ceremony.

A source has previously told this PEOPLE the athlete has navigated increasing stress amid both recovery and ongoing legal issues. “This has created a lot of stress,” the insider said, adding that Woods is “doing the best he can” amid the pressure to heal.

Woods was charged with DUI after a crash in March in Jupiter Island, Florida, and has pleaded not guilty to misdemeanor DUI with property damage. He also pleaded not guilty to refusing to submit to a lawful test after refusing a urinalysis. Woods is due back in court on July 7.
